Beyond direct investment, staking and yield farming have emerged as significant income-generating strategies within the decentralized finance (DeFi) space. Staking involves locking up your cryptocurrency holdings to support the operations of a blockchain network (often those using Proof-of-Stake consensus mechanisms). In return for your contribution, you earn rewards, typically in the form of more of the same cryptocurrency. It’s akin to earning interest in a savings account, but often with much higher yields, albeit with associated risks. Yield farming takes this a step further. It involves providing liquidity to decentralized exchanges (DEXs) or lending protocols. By depositing your crypto assets into liquidity pools, you facilitate trading and lending activities, and in return, you earn a share of the transaction fees and often additional reward tokens. This can be highly lucrative, but it requires a deeper understanding of impermanent loss (the risk of your deposited assets decreasing in value compared to simply holding them) and the specific mechanics of different DeFi protocols.

For those looking to generate passive income, lending protocols within DeFi represent a significant avenue. Platforms like Aave, Compound, and MakerDAO allow users to deposit their cryptocurrencies and earn interest from borrowers. These interest rates are often dynamic, influenced by supply and demand, but can significantly outperform traditional savings accounts. The key here is to understand the collateralization ratios, liquidation thresholds, and the specific risks associated with each protocol. Depositing stablecoins (cryptocurrencies pegged to a stable asset like the US dollar) can mitigate some of the price volatility associated with volatile crypto assets, allowing for more predictable interest income.
Beyond lending, crypto savings accounts offered by various platforms provide a simplified way to earn interest on your digital assets. While not as decentralized as some DeFi protocols, they offer a user-friendly interface and often competitive rates, making them an accessible option for many. Researching the reputation, security measures, and fund custody practices of these platforms is crucial to ensure the safety of your funds.

For the more technically inclined, running blockchain nodes can be a sophisticated way to earn. By dedicating computing resources to maintain and validate transactions on a blockchain network, you can receive rewards. This is particularly relevant for Proof-of-Stake networks, where running a validator node requires staking a significant amount of the network's native cryptocurrency. This offers a direct contribution to the network's security and decentralization, with commensurate rewards. The technical expertise and capital investment required are higher, but the earning potential can be substantial.

However, it's imperative to address the inherent risks associated with earning through blockchain. Volatility is perhaps the most well-known. The prices of many cryptocurrencies can fluctuate dramatically in short periods, leading to significant potential losses if not managed carefully. Smart contract risks are also a concern. Bugs or vulnerabilities in smart contract code can be exploited by malicious actors, leading to the loss of funds. Regulatory uncertainty remains a factor, as governments worldwide grapple with how to regulate the burgeoning digital asset space, which could impact the value and accessibility of certain assets and protocols.
Scams and rug pulls are prevalent in the crypto space, particularly in newer or less established projects. Thorough due diligence, skepticism towards overly optimistic promises, and understanding the red flags are essential to avoid falling victim. Impermanent loss in yield farming, as mentioned earlier, is another risk where the value of your deposited assets can decrease compared to simply holding them.
